After having lost a blowout in their previous game against Gunter, Blue Ridge was happy to have turned things around on Tuesday. They had just enough and edged out the Howe Bulldogs 7-5. The win continues a trend for the Tigers in their matchups with the Bulldogs: they've now won four in a row.

The team relied heavily on Kyara Davis, who went 3-for-4 with one home run, five RBI, and two runs. Those three hits gave her a new career-high. Miranda Caro was another key player, scoring two runs and stealing a base while going 2-for-4.
Blue Ridge's victory bumped their record up to 4-6. As for Howe, their loss was their 13th straight at home dating back to last season, which dropped their record down to 4-15.
Both squads are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Blue Ridge will square off against S & S Consolidated at 6:30 p.m. on Friday. The Rams will roll in looking for their 16th straight win, something the Tigers surely won't give up without a fight. As for Howe, they will challenge Leonard at 5:00 p.m. on Friday.
